The Women's Missionary Society of the Pacific Coast of the Methodist Episcopal Church was founded on October 29, 1870 by Methodist Rev. Otis T. Gibson, [1] with eleven women he recruited in August 1870, for the purpose of working among the slave girls in Chinatown, San Francisco, California. [2]

The Christian Woman's Board of Missions (CWBM) was a missionary organization associated with the Restoration Movement. [1] Established in 1874, it was the first such group managed entirely by women. [1] It hired both men and women, and supported both domestic and foreign missions. [1]

The Evangelical Alliance Mission (TEAM) is an inter-denominational evangelical Christian missionary organization founded by Fredrik Franson.As a global missions agency, TEAM partners with the global church in sending disciples who make disciples and establish missional churches to the glory of God, going where the most people have the most need and proclaiming the gospel in both word and action.
